Manager Clinical Engineering Overview
To provide responsive leadership to the BioMedical Engineering Department, enabling staff to provide high quality services and maintain medical equipment. The department will strive to achieve continuously improved services by ensuring regulatory compliance and safety standards, and by meeting or exceeding customers’ needs.
Clinical Engineering Manager Key Responsibilities and Expectations
- Develop a 3- to-5-year plan for medical equipment evaluation and replacement.
- Ensures 100% regulatory compliance related to clinical equipment inspections and provides operational and technical direction to Clinical Engineering staff.
- Prepares quality improvement plans and identifies departmental goals.
- Develops annual department operating plans, including operating and capital budgets, consistent with corporate objectives.
- Assists with identification, communication, and resolution of applicable product recalls and alerts.
- Ensures all departments receive equipment status updates.
- Identifies trends and/or concerns regarding clinical equipment and recommends replacement needs to ensure accomplishment of organizational objectives.
- Prepares medical equipment tactics to meet current and future needs of the organization and department.
- Reviews all capital requests for clinical equipment to ensure that they are cost-effective, standardized, high quality and meet the needs of the customer and organization.
- Reviews requests for proposals to receive new services (service contracts) from outside contractors.
- Attends and participates in the Capital Asset Subcommittee (CASC) to help ensure equipment needs are reviewed and the best equipment for the intended purposes is purchased.
- Develops service improvements, managed systems and expense control programs to ensure maximum cost savings and improve profitability.
- Serves as coordinator for the Medical Equipment dimension of the Environment of Care Committee.
- Develops Environment of Care (EOC) Management Reports (quarterly, annual and annual evaluation).
- Demonstrate commitment to organizational Values of Compassion, Trust, Respect, Teamwork, and Innovation
Position Requirements
- Bachelor’s Degree in Technology or other healthcare-related field.
- Three (3) years’ experience as a Supervisor or Manager Clinical Engineering, or five (5) years’ experience as a Senior Biomedical Equipment Specialist/Technician is preferred.

About United Health Services
United Health Services is a not-for-profit healthcare system serving more than 500,000 people in Upstate New York’s Southern Tier region. We offer integrated healthcare services across 60 locations, including four hospitals, three walk-in centers, and 22 primary care offices, in addition to home care services and senior living facilities. The United Health Services system employs more than 6,300 people and comprises 600+ providers who are all committed to providing and supporting the delivery of exceptional patient care.
